Integrity
Integrity was the quality of living out honesty and morality.
In 2267, Captain James T. Kirk, as a gambit to incite anger in Spock to free him from the influence of pod plant spores, described him as a traitor from a race of traitors, that a Vulcan had never lived who had an ounce of integrity. (TOS: "This Side of Paradise")
That same year, speaking honestly to Spock's mirror universe counterpart, Kirk described him as "a man of integrity in both universes". (TOS: "Mirror, Mirror")
In 2268, a Romulan commander stated that she could appreciate Vulcans as the Romulans' distant brothers, that she had heard of Vulcan integrity and personal honor and that there was a well-known saying, or possibly a myth, that Vulcans were incapable of lying. (TOS: "The Enterprise Incident")
In 2373, Lieutenant Tuvok told Marayna that he respected Ensign Harry Kim for his intelligence and integrity and assumed he held him in the same regard, but did not consider him a friend for this was an emotional dimension that Vulcans did not experience. (VOY: "Alter Ego")
That same year, when being interviewed by Doctor Lewis Zimmerman regarding the nature of Doctor Julian Bashir as part of a plan to use him as a model for the long-term Medical Holographic program, Chief Miles O'Brien described him as being an extraordinary person with a real sense of honor and integrity. (DS9: "Doctor Bashir, I Presume")
